Next-generation solid-state battery pack by BASF and Welion unveiled

At Guangzhou International Automobile Exhibition, a next-generation solid-state battery pack co-developed by Welion New Energy Technology and BASF, which contribute to vehicle weight reduction, thermal management, and enhanced safety performance in electric vehicles (EVs), was unveiled.

The next-generation solid-state battery pack co-developed by Welion New Energy Technology and BASF.

 

The battery pack incorporates innovative material solutions from BASF, including engineering plastics Ultramid and Ultradur and polyurethanes Elastolit, Elastoflex, Elastan, and Eastocoat.

 

BASF’s advanced materials elevate battery safety and performance. The flame-retardant cell holder delivers exceptional electrical insulation and meets stringent standards. Fire-resistant compounds in extruded high-voltage busbars ensure superior metal adhesion and flow versus polyamide 12 (PA12). Elastolit foaming potting adhesive and Elastocoat fire-protection coatings further reinforce thermal runaway resistance.

 

When combined, BASF’s material solutions safeguard against thermal runaway, mechanical impact, overcharging, and short-circuit risks, engineered under China national GB 38031 standard, and aligning with global battery standards.

 

“By eliminating the hazards of flammable liquid electrolytes, the solid-state design delivers exceptional thermal stability. It also tackles key challenges in charging speed and driving range - accelerating the mainstream adoption of solid-state batteries and bringing consumers safer, smarter, and more reliable electric vehicles,” explained Huigen Yu, Chairman, Welion.

 

Additionally, BASF’s solutions contribute to vehicle weight reduction, which is critical for maximizing EV efficiency.

 

BASF's Ultramid PA side cooling manifold and Elastoflex PU Stray Transfer Molding (STM) battery cover cut weight by about 50% compared to metal alternatives. Elastan low-density structural adhesive optimizes structural integrity, meeting the dual demands of safety and lightweighting. Additional polyurethane structural filling and polyurea coatings further increase battery impact strength. 

 

“We constantly advance our portfolio with our material innovation expertise to meet dynamic regulatory demands and support our customers and automotive OEMs in their green transformation,” said Andy Postlethwaite, Senior Vice President, Performance Materials Asia Pacific at BASF.
